Kyivstar to Release 3Q26 Earnings on November 6, 2026 Reschedules Capital Markets Day to November 17, 2026

GlobeNewsWire · 2 Sept 2026neutral

Kyivstar Group announced it will release its consolidated financial and operating results for the third quarter ended September 30, 2026, on November 6, 2026, and will host a conference call with senior management following the release. It also rescheduled its Capital Markets Day to November 17, 2026.

Kyivstar Q2 Earnings: A New Entry Point Might Have Emerged

Seeking Alpha · 10 Aug 2026positive

Kyivstar Group reported another strong Q2 with robust digitalisation and sustainable profit margins, while raising full-year guidance for both revenue and EBITDA. CapEx intensity remains high due to expansion of an in-house energy portfolio, and the FX translation impact was subdued, with strategic initiatives such as Starlink direct-to-cell gaining prominence.

Kyivstar Group Q2 Earnings Call Highlights

MarketBeat · 31 July 2026positive

Kyivstar Group reported Q2 revenue of $339 million, a 19% year-over-year increase, driven by growth in telecom operations and its digital ecosystem. The company raised its full-year outlook for the second time.

Kyivstar Opens New York Office at Rockefeller Center, Deepening Connection to U.S. Investors and International Partners

GlobeNewsWire · 29 July 2026positive

Kyivstar Group Ltd. has opened a new office at Rockefeller Center in New York City, establishing a dedicated investor relations presence in the U.S. and becoming the first Ukrainian company listed on a U.S. stock exchange to do so.

What is the KYIV stock forecast for 2030?

No analyst covering Kyivstar Group Ltd. publishes a 2030 price target — Wall Street targets run 12 to 18 months out. Sites quoting a 2030 price for KYIV are extrapolating price history, which says nothing about the business. The furthest attributed numbers are the current analyst targets: $15 to $20 over the next 12 months.

About Kyivstar Group Ltd.

Kyivstar Group Ltd. is a telecommunications and digital services company focused on providing mobile, fixed-line, and broadband connectivity in Ukraine. Its core offerings include voice, messaging, mobile data, home internet, and business connectivity services, supported by digital products such as cloud solutions, cybersecurity, digital television, big data services, and enterprise communications tools. The company also serves consumers and corporate clients through a broad portfolio that includes self-service platforms and related digital solutions. Kyivstar Group Ltd. plays an important role in Ukraine’s communications market as a major provider of everyday connectivity and enterprise digital infrastructure. Its operations are centered on serving residential users, businesses, and organizations that rely on reliable network access and integrated telecom services.
